外文关键词:Acupuncture; Pain-induced emotions; Neuroplasticity; Functional neuroplasticity; Structural neuroplasticity
摘要:Pain-induced emotions are the negative moods caused by pain, such as depression and anxiety. Acupuncture can effectively relieve pain-induced emotions, and its mechanism is closely related to the regulation of neuroplasticity. Neuroplasticity is composed of two types, functional neuroplasticity and structural neuroplasticity. (1) Acupuncture improves functional neuroplasticity by inhibiting the activation of microglia and astrocytes, regulating the expression of neurotransmitters and receptors, modulating cellular signal transduction pathways, and optimizing synaptic transmission efficiency. (2) Acupuncture improves structural neuroplasticity by modulating neuronal synaptic plasticity, inhibiting neuronal apoptosis, and up-regulating the expression of the BDNF/TrKB/CREB signaling pathway. Additionally, acupuncture up-regulates the expression of brain-derived neurotrophic factors to improve both the functional and structural neuroplasticity, thus relieves pain-induced emotions. The above discovery provides an approach to the mechanism research of acupuncture for pain-induced emotions. (c) 2025 World Journal of Acupuncture-Moxibustion House.
